    Abstract: A nebulizer comprising of an elongated body including a nebulized fluid emission opening at one end with a nebulizer fluid reservoir communicating with the opening and a fluid barrier means adjacent to the opening. A wick extends between the reservoir and barrier for conveying nebulizer fluid to the barrier region from the reservoir. A source of pressurized gas is within a housing along with a means for conveying the pressurized gas to the wick in the region of the barrier. The conveying means includes a perforated section which extends into the region of the wick and through the barrier. The pressurized gas traverses the conducting means and aspirates the nebulizer fluid during passage through the barrier. The perforated section is a helical spring and the wick is a carpet-like fabric. A novel form of perforated barrier in the form of a closely spaced helical spring is enclosed. A novel filter formed from a knurled rod within a passage also is disclosed.

    Abstract: A circular gas discharge reflector lamp has a ballast supporting structure enclosing a ballast and having a male screw shell extending therefrom. Lamp engaging arms extend from the structure and hold a circular gas discharge lamp which is electrically connected to the ballast and screw shell in an operative circuit. A concave reflector partially enclosing the lamp and attached to the ballast supporting structure near the male screw shell. A lens attached at its perimeter to the perimeter of the reflector, which transmits the direct light emitted by the lamp and also transmits the reflected light from the reflector. The screw shell, ballast supporting structure, reflector and lens are joined together with continuously sealed seams whereby the reflector lamp is water tight.

    Abstract: A thermoplastic cylindrical clamp is manufactured by heating a flat sheet of thermoplastic material, thermoforming the softened sheet over a mold having two parallel and semicylindrical shapes with a narrow planar space between them and a coplanar flange surrounding, trimming the thermoformed sheet so the semicylinders are open at each end, locally heating the narrow planar portion between the semicylinders to the softening point, bending the softened portion so the semicylinders form a complete cylinder and cooling the part in the cylindrical shape.

    Abstract: A fluorescent lampholder fitting has a fluorescent lamp having first and second ends respectively provided with starting filaments. The lamp is supported by a housing which also encloses a solid-state fluorescent ballast and which also incorporates a male screw base electrical connector for supporting the housing in a portable lamp or lighting fixture. The male screw base is provided with three electrical input connections so configured to be electrically connected and selectively switched when installed in a three-way lampholder of the portable lamp or lighting fixture. The lampholder fitting is provided with a center-tapped step-down transformer which has three terminals attached to the three respective connections of the three-way male screw base. The step-down transformer has a single low-voltage secondary winding which connects to the input terminals of a full-wave bridge rectifier which has its rectified output connected to a high frequency oscillator.

    Abstract: A method for starting and operating a preheat type fluorescent lamp includes a source of alternating current, a fluorescent lamp having a low impedance starting mode wherein current passes through one or more starting filaments and a high impedance operating mode wherein current passes through the length of the lamp, a starting switch directing current through the starting filaments in the lamp starting mode, and an inductor ballast having a magnetically permeable core operating in a saturated condition when the lamp is in the low impedance starting mode and in a non-saturated condition when the lamp is in the high impedance operating mode.
